Why These Specs Matter

The Samsung M393B1K70CH0-YH9Q8 is a server-grade DDR3 Registered DIMM, engineered for mission-critical enterprise environments where downtime is not an option. Its defining features directly address the pain points of data center architects and IT managers.

First, ECC error correction continuously detects and corrects single-bit memory errors caused by background radiation, preventing silent data corruption in financial transaction databases or long-running analytics jobs. This means a flipped bit will never quietly cascade into a faulty calculation or a crashed virtual machine. Second, the Registered signal buffer isolates the memory controller from the electrical load of multiple DIMMs, enabling stable operation with large-capacity memory configurations. In a dense virtualization cluster hosting dozens of VMs, this stability allows you to populate all channels without risking signal integrity, maximizing host memory density. Third, the 1.35V low-voltage operation significantly reduces power draw and thermal output across a rack full of servers, which lowers cooling overhead and extends component lifespan. Finally, the Dual Rank x4 organization combined with 1333MHz speed delivers strong interleaved bandwidth for memory-intensive workloads like Redis or Memcached, effectively doubling the internal page-hit rate and accelerating key-value lookups. For the data center, this translates into reliable, efficient, and responsive infrastructure you can trust around the clock.

General Virtualization
This registered DDR3-1333 8GB module suits entry-level virtualization hosts where total memory is more critical than raw bandwidth. For a typical two-socket server, populate at least six identical DIMMs per CPU (12 modules total, 96GB) to balance memory channels and support 20–30 light VMs. Always install modules in matched sets per memory bank to maintain ECC protection and avoid performance penalties from unbalanced NUMA configurations.

In-Memory Database
In-memory databases demand both capacity and reliability, making this dual-rank x4 RDIMM a solid building block. Deploy a fully populated 24-DIMM server configuration (192GB) to hold substantial datasets entirely in RAM while benefiting from ECC error correction. Prioritize identical 1.35V low-voltage modules to reduce thermal load and power draw in dense deployments, ensuring stable latencies under sustained write-intensive workloads.

High Performance Computing
For HPC clusters where memory bandwidth per core is crucial, use these ECC Registered DIMMs in a balanced, multi-channel configuration. In a dual-socket node with eight memory channels per CPU, install eight modules (64GB) to maximize bandwidth via channel interleaving. The CAS 9 latency and 1.35V operation help maintain energy efficiency across scale-out nodes, while ECC safeguards long-running computational integrity against single-bit errors.

FAQ

Q: Can I mix this M393B1K70CH0-YH9Q8 with other memory modules of different brands or speeds?

A: Mixing is not recommended. Mismatched brands, speeds, or ranks often cause stability issues and prevent the server from booting. For guaranteed reliability, populate all channels with identical Samsung RDIMMs meeting the same PC3-10600 specification.

Q: Is this memory compatible with my Intel Xeon E5-2600 v2 series server platform?

A: Yes, this DDR3-1333 Registered ECC module is fully compatible with systems using Intel C602/C604 chipsets. Verify your motherboard supports 1.35V low-voltage operation and Registered DIMMs. Always consult the vendor’s qualified memory list for your specific server model.

Q: What is the recommended DIMM population order for optimal performance?

A: For dual-socket servers, balance ranks across memory channels as per the motherboard manual. Typically, populate identical RDIMMs starting with the slots furthest from the CPU, filling blue or black slots first. Install in matched pairs per channel for dual rank interleaving.

Q: Does this module support overclocking or XMP profiles?

A: No. This is an enterprise server RDIMM conforming to JEDEC standards. It runs at fixed 1333MHz with CL9 latency and does not support XMP or overclocking. Stability and data integrity are prioritized over tunable performance.
